亲爱的读者们,你是否曾在某个闲暇时刻,刷着短视频,被那些精彩纷呈的直播内容深深吸引?你是否想过,这些让人欲罢不能的短视频直播背后,究竟隐藏着怎样的秘密?今天,就让我带你一探究竟,揭开短视频直播源码的神秘面纱!
一、短视频直播源码:揭秘直播背后的技术奥秘
短视频直播源码,顾名思义,就是短视频直播平台所使用的编程代码。这些代码犹如直播世界的“灵魂”,让直播内容得以流畅呈现。那么,这些源码究竟是如何运作的呢?
1. 视频采集与编码
首先,直播源码需要采集视频信号。这通常通过摄像头完成,将现实世界的画面转化为数字信号。接下来,源码会对这些信号进行编码,将其压缩成适合网络传输的格式,如H.264、H.265等。

2. 网络传输
编码后的视频信号需要通过网络传输到观众端。直播源码会利用HTTP、RTMP等协议,将视频数据实时传输到服务器,再由服务器分发到各个观众设备。

3. 视频解码与播放
观众端的设备接收到视频数据后,直播源码会对其进行解码,将压缩的视频信号还原成原始画面。随后,观众就可以在手机、电脑等设备上欣赏到直播内容了。

二、短视频直播源码:热门平台的技术解析
目前,市场上涌现出众多短视频直播平台,如抖音、快手、斗鱼等。这些平台在技术层面各有特色,下面我们来解析一下它们的技术优势。
1. 抖音
抖音作为短视频领域的领军者,其直播源码在视频采集、编码、传输等方面都表现出色。此外,抖音还拥有强大的AI推荐算法,能够为用户推荐感兴趣的内容。
2. 快手
快手在直播源码方面同样具有优势,其视频采集、编码、传输等技术都达到了行业领先水平。此外,快手还注重社区建设,为用户提供良好的互动体验。
3. 斗鱼
斗鱼作为直播领域的佼佼者,其直播源码在视频采集、编码、传输等方面同样表现出色。斗鱼还拥有丰富的游戏直播资源,吸引了大量游戏爱好者。
三、短视频直播源码:发展趋势与挑战
随着短视频直播行业的快速发展,直播源码技术也在不断进步。以下是一些发展趋势与挑战:
1. 发展趋势
(1)5G时代的到来,将为直播源码带来更高的传输速度和更低的延迟。
(2)AI技术的应用,将进一步提升直播内容的个性化推荐和互动体验。
(3)直播源码的开放性,将促进更多创新应用的出现。
2. 挑战
(1)直播内容监管压力增大,直播源码需要具备更强的内容审核能力。
(2)网络安全问题日益突出,直播源码需要加强安全防护。
四、短视频直播源码:如何获取与学习
如果你对短视频直播源码感兴趣,以下是一些建议:
1. 学习编程语言:掌握如Java、Python等编程语言,为学习直播源码打下基础。
2. 了解相关技术:学习视频采集、编码、传输等相关技术,了解直播源码的运作原理。
3. 关注开源项目:参与开源项目,了解直播源码的实际应用。
4. 深入研究:阅读相关书籍、论文,深入研究直播源码技术。
短视频直播源码是直播行业发展的关键因素。通过本文的介绍,相信你对直播源码有了更深入的了解。让我们一起期待,未来短视频直播行业将带给我们更多精彩内容!